8 Content Marketing Strategies for Startup Growth

Jun 26, 2023 | Content Marketing

In today’s digital age, content marketing has become an essential strategy for startup growth. By creating and distributing valuable, relevant, and consistent content, startups can attract and engage their target audience, establish credibility, and ultimately drive growth. In this article, we will explore effective content marketing strategies that can help startups stand out from the competition and achieve sustainable growth.

1. Define Your Target Audience

Before diving into content creation, it’s crucial to identify and understand your target audience. Conduct market research to gain insights into their demographics, interests, pain points, and online behavior. By knowing your audience inside out, you can tailor your content to their specific needs and preferences, ensuring maximum impact.

2. Develop a Content Strategy

A well-defined content strategy is the foundation of successful content marketing. Start by setting clear goals and objectives for your content, such as increasing brand awareness, generating leads, or driving conversions. Determine the key messages and themes that align with your startup’s values and expertise. Create an editorial calendar to plan and organize your content creation efforts, ensuring a consistent flow of valuable content.

3. Create High-Quality and Engaging Content

When it comes to content marketing, quality trumps quantity. Focus on creating high-quality content that offers value to your target audience. Use a conversational writing style that resonates with readers and showcases your startup’s personality. Incorporate relevant keywords naturally within your content to improve search engine visibility. Format your content for readability by using subheadings, bullet points, and short paragraphs.

4. Utilize Different Content Formats

To cater to diverse audience preferences, leverage various content formats. Besides written articles, consider creating videos, infographics, podcasts, and interactive content. Visual and interactive elements can enhance user engagement and make your content more shareable on social media platforms. Experiment with different formats to find what works best for your startup and resonates with your target audience.

5. Leverage Social Media

Social media platforms are powerful tools for content distribution and audience engagement. Identify the social media channels where your target audience is most active and establish a strong presence there. Share your content regularly, engage with your followers, and encourage them to share your content with their networks. Use relevant hashtags to increase discoverability and join industry-specific conversations to position your startup as a thought leader.

6. Guest Blogging and Influencer Collaborations

Collaborating with industry influencers and guest blogging on authoritative websites can expand your startup’s reach and build credibility. Identify influencers who align with your brand values and have a substantial following. Reach out to them with a personalized pitch, offering valuable content or partnerships. Guest blogging on reputable websites allows you to tap into their established audience base and gain exposure to new potential customers.

7. Implement SEO Best Practices

While the focus should be on creating valuable content, optimizing it for search engines is essential for organic visibility. Conduct keyword research to identify relevant keywords and incorporate them strategically within your content, headings, and meta tags. Optimize your website’s loading speed, improve its mobile responsiveness, and ensure it has clear site navigation. Regularly update and repurpose your content to keep it fresh and relevant.

8. Measure and Analyze Performance

To gauge the effectiveness of your content marketing efforts, track and analyze key performance metrics. Utilize tools like Google Analytics to monitor website traffic, engagement, conversion rates, and social media analytics. Identify which types of content perform best and resonate most with your audience. Use the insights gained to refine your content strategy, optimize underperforming content, and experiment with new approaches.

In a competitive startup landscape, effective content marketing strategies can be the differentiating factor for sustainable growth. By understanding their target audience, creating high-quality content, leveraging various formats, and utilizing social media, startups can position themselves as industry leaders, attract a loyal following, and drive growth. Implementing SEO best practices, collaborating with influencers, and consistently measuring performance is vital for maximizing the impact of your content marketing efforts.
